By Teddy Nwanunobi

Abuja (Sundiata Post) — Kaduna State Governor, Nasir Ahmad El-Rufai, on Sunday, felicitated with Christians on the occasion of Easter, pointing out that the sacrificial death of Jesus Christ also embodies “hope, liberation and victory over darkness”.

This is even as El-Rufai has strongly condemned the weekend attack on Asso community in Gwong Chiefdom of the Jema’a Local Government Area of the State.

In his Easter message, El-Rufai urged the people of the State to embrace the lessons of Easter as a practical guide to life.

“The sacrifice of Jesus Christ, through the sadness, pain and despair of the Crucifixion, also embodied hope, liberation and victory over darkness, as evidenced in the Resurrection.

“Through tough and calm times, people of faith have an example to emulate.

“Easter is a pointer to the power of hope, and a demonstration that sacrifice ultimately brings liberation and victory,” he said in a statement issued by his Special Assistant (Media and Publicity), Samuel Aruwan.

El-Rufai expressed the hope that universal message of a common humanity will spur Nigerians to uphold peace and harmony, and to always embrace others as part of the great family God has created.

Meanwhile, El-Rufai has condemned Asso’s ttack, and urged communities to support ‘Operation Harbin Kunama II’ against bandits.

El-Rufai said that the forthcoming Operation Harbin Kunama II is a necessary step towards ending the violence in parts of southern Kaduna.

The Governor spoke, while condemning the weekend attack on Asso community in Gwong Chiefdom of Jema’a Local Government Area of the State.

In a statement issued in Kaduna by his spokesman, Aruwan, the Governor extended his condolence to the victims and their families, while affirming that security operations are being ramped to rid the forest areas of the bandits.

The Governor charged security agencies to redouble their efforts in fishing out those behind the killings, and to act promptly on carefully vetted intelligence.

The statement said that agencies responsible for emergency services have been directed to offer relief.

The Governor requested support from communities to the security agencies as the Nigerian Army gets set to commence a major operation tagged ‘Operation Harbin Kunama II’, including assisting the Nigerian Army with vital information that could aid a successful clampdown on elements responsible for this terror attacks on our citizens.
